| Spec | Damon Howatt (Martin Archery) Savannah | October Mountain Products Ozark Hunter |
|---|---|---|
| Street Price | $825 | $192.99 |
| Construction | Hybrid-reflex-deflex | One-piece-laminated |
| Bow Length | 62" | 68" |
| Lightest Draw Offered | 40 lb | 35 lb |
| Heaviest Draw Offered | 65 lb | 55 lb |
| Mass Weight | 1.06 lb | — |
